A dance studio has two participation plans. For the first plan, the cost is $20 per visit. For the second plan, the cost is $45 per month, and $5 per visit. Write an equation to show the number of visits per month that it would take for the two plans to be equal. Use x as your variable. To find the number of visits per month where the costs of both plans are equal, we can set up the equations based on the two plans:
1. **First plan**: The cost is $20 per visit, so the total cost for \(x\) visits will be:
\[
C_1 = 20x
\]
2. **Second plan**: The cost is $45 per month plus $5 per visit, so the total cost for \(x\) visits will be:
\[
C_2 = 45 + 5x
\]
To find when these two costs are equal, we set the equations equal to each other:
\[
20x = 45 + 5x
\]
Thus, the equation you are looking for is:
\[
20x = 45 + 5x
\]
